Select Page

6 Top Scraping Tools That
You Cannot Miss in 2024

Favicon
Author : Jyothish

AIMLEAP Automation Works Startups | Digital | Innovation | Transformation

6 Top Scraping Tools That You Cannot Miss in 2024
Favicon
Author : Jyothish

AIMLEAP Automation Works Startups | Digital | Innovation | Transformation

In the rapidly evolving landscape of the digital age, data has become a currency that drives decision-making, innovation, and competitive advantage. To harness the power of information, businesses and individuals are increasingly turning to the best web crawler tools available in the market. These tools play a crucial role in extracting valuable data from websites efficiently and at a scale.  

Having access to precise and current information is crucial for both businesses and individuals. This is where the role of data scraping software becomes pivotal, transforming the way we collect data from websites. 

These tools can efficiently and automatically collect and structure extensive datasets within minutes. Consequently, they have become essential for tasks such as competitive analysis, market research, and lead generation. 

What is Web Scraping?

Best Web Crawler Tools

Web scraping, alternatively termed web harvesting or web data extraction, is the method of extracting data from websites. It encompasses the utilization of software or programming techniques to access and fetch information from web pages, with the extracted data then being saved, analyzed, or manipulated for diverse purposes.

While manual web scraping is an option, it is frequently automated through dedicated Python web scraping tools or the creation of custom scripts using programming languages. It is crucial to note that ethical and legal considerations must guide web scraping activities, ensuring compliance with the terms of service and copyright laws of the websites being scraped.

Importance and Benefits of Scraping Tools

  • Time Efficiency: Manual data extraction is time-consuming and prone to errors. The best web crawler tools automate this process, allowing users to retrieve large volumes of data in a fraction of the time it would take manually.
  • Accuracy and Consistency: Automation ensures that data extraction is performed with precision and consistency, reducing the likelihood of human errors that can occur during manual processes.
  • Competitive Intelligence: Staying informed about market trends, competitor activities, and customer behavior is essential for any business. Scraping tools enable organizations to gather competitive intelligence swiftly and comprehensively.
  • Real-time Data: In fast-paced industries, having access to real-time data is critical. The best web crawler tools can be configured to extract and update information regularly, providing users with the most up-to-date insights.
  • Cost Savings: Automating data extraction not only saves time but also reduces labor costs associated with manual processes. This makes data scraping software cost-effective solution for businesses of all sizes.
  • Strategic Decision-making: Informed decision-making relies on accurate and timely data. The best web crawler tools empower businesses to make strategic decisions based on a comprehensive understanding of the market and relevant trends.

Now, let’s explore the six best web crawler tools that will be indispensable in 2024.

1.APISCRAPY

Apiscrapy

APISCRAPY stands out as one of the best web crawler tools that combines ease of use with advanced features. Its user-friendly interface makes it accessible to beginners, while its robust capabilities cater to the needs of experienced developers and data scientists.

Key Features of APISCRAPY

  • Converts Any Web Data into Ready-to-Use Data API: APISCRAPY’s data API facilitates the conversion of web data into a structured, usable format, eliminating the need for manual processing or data formatting. 
  • No Coding & No Infra Required: It is a user-friendly tool that simplifies web scraping tasks without requiring extensive coding skills or complex infrastructure setup, making it accessible to individuals without programming background. 
  • Automation-Based Process: APISCRAPY utilizes an automation-centric approach for efficient web scraping, saving time and ensuring consistency and accuracy in repetitive data extraction tasks from multiple web pages or periodic updates. 
  • Any Format Data Delivery: It offers versatile data delivery options, including CSV, JSON, and Excel, enabling seamless integration into various applications or platforms without additional conversion steps. 
  • Database Integration: APISCRAPY’s seamless integration with databases allows users to efficiently store and retrieve scraped data, making it a valuable tool for centralized data storage and retrieval.  

APISCRAPY is robust data scraping software that offers automation, versatility, and ease of use, converting web data into APIs, supporting various data formats, and seamlessly integrating with databases.

2.ParseHub

Parsehub

ParseHub stands second in the best web crawler tools list and caters to both novices and seasoned users with its user-friendly interface and efficiency. It adopts a visual approach, enabling users to interact with target websites and establish extraction rules without the necessity of coding skills. Noteworthy features include automatic IP rotation, text and HTML extraction, scheduled scraping, and attribute extraction.

Key Features of ParseHub

  • Automated Data Extraction: It automates data extraction from websites, eliminating manual copying and pasting, and navigates intricate, dynamic content and interactive elements. 
  • Visual Approach and Flexibility: The website’s visual interface is designed for non-technical users, allowing them to interact with the target website and define extraction rules using various methods. 
  • API Integration and Data Output Formats: ParseHub transforms dynamic websites into APIs, supports data output in CSV and JSON formats, and allows users to integrate APIs for data collection and organization. 
  • IP Rotation and Scheduled Scraping: ParseHub offers efficient data collection through features like automatic IP rotation, scheduled scraping, and attribute extraction, allowing users to schedule regular extraction times.
  • Data Access and User Interface: The unified user interface allows team members to easily access data in various file formats, promoting collaboration and efficient data utilization. 

In summary, ParseHub emerges as a comprehensive and user-friendly web scraping tool, well-suited for a broad spectrum of data extraction and analysis requirements.

3.Scrapy

Scrapy

Scrapy stands out as a rapid, high-level, open-source framework designed for web crawling and web scraping. Tailored for extracting structured data from websites, Scrapy finds utility in diverse applications, including data mining, monitoring, and automated testing.

Key Features of Scrapy

  • Built-in Data Selection and Extraction Support: Scrapy boasts built-in support for selecting and extracting data from HTML and XML sources, employing XPath or CSS expressions.  
  • HTTP Feature Set: Scrapy encompasses a range of HTTP features, including compression, authentication, caching, user-agent spoofing, robots.txt compliance, and crawl depth restriction.  
  • Concurrency and Fault-Tolerance: The framework, Scrapy, facilitates data extraction through multiple concurrent requests and handles them with fault-tolerance, automatically retrying failed requests. 
  • Crawl Politeness: Scrapy allows users to control the crawling process by setting download delays, limiting concurrent requests, and adjusting other parameters for polite and respectful crawling. 
  • Feed Exports: Scrapy offers the capability to generate feed exports in various formats such as JSON, CSV, and XML. This facilitates easy sharing and utilization of the extracted data. 

In summary, Scrapy emerges as a potent and efficient tool for web scraping and data extraction tasks, thanks to its rich feature set designed to enhance flexibility, performance, and user control.

4.Octoparse

Octoparse

Octoparse is a user-friendly and one of the best web crawler tools designed for non-programmers. Its point-and-click interface makes it accessible to individuals with limited coding skills, offering a straightforward approach to data extraction.

Key Features of Octoparse

  • Intuitive Point-and-Click Interface: It is a user-friendly web scraping tool that supports both experienced and novice users, is compatible with Windows XP, 7, 8, and 10, and can handle both static and dynamic websites. 
  • Diverse Data Export Formats: Data extracted with Octoparse can be conveniently exported in various formats such as CSV, Excel, HTML, or TXT, and directly to databases like MySQL, SQL Server, and Oracle via API. 
  • Cloud Extraction and Storage: Octoparse introduces cloud extraction capabilities, ensuring 24/7 data extraction through multiple servers, securely stored in the cloud for easy access from any device. 
  • Automatic IP Rotation: The tool facilitates automatic IP rotation, a valuable feature for extensive extraction needs, ensuring efficiency in data collection.
  • API Integration and Scheduled Extraction: This data scraping software streamlines data collection and organization from various sources through seamless API integration. It also schedules extraction for regular retrieval at specified intervals. 

These collective features position Octoparse as a comprehensive end-to-end solution for web data extraction. Its versatility makes it applicable across various industries and businesses, providing users with a smooth and efficient experience for web scraping and data extraction tasks.

5. Apify

Apify

Apify is a versatile cloud-based platform that excels in web scraping, browser automation, and seamless data extraction, offering over 200 ready-made tools for diverse applications and industries. With features like web automation, business intelligence support, and a robust proxy system, Apify simplifies and enhances data-driven tasks for users across various sectors.

Key Features of Apify

  • Web Scraping and Data Extraction: Apify provides pre-built web scraping and data extraction, , offering adaptable migration options, and supporting data processing across multiple projects.  
  • Web Automation and Robotic Process Automation (RPA): Apify allows users to automate manual web workflows through web automation and Robotic Process Automation (RPA), enabling time savings and empowering repetitive tasks.  
  • Business Intelligence: It serves as a source of data for generative AI and business intelligence, facilitating the analysis and visualization of data for informed decision-making. 
  • Apify Proxies: It includes a pool of residential and datacenter proxies dedicated to web scraping and data extraction. This ensures users can access websites without encountering blocks or detection. 
  • Monitoring and Alerts: It offers monitoring features for users to track automation script performance and set metric alerts, enabling proactive management of data extraction and automation tasks.  

These collective features position Apify as a comprehensive and user-friendly platform for web scraping, data extraction, and automation endeavors. Its versatility makes it applicable across a broad spectrum of industries and businesses.

Preferred Partner For High Growth

6. Scraper API

Scraper Api

Scraper API introduces a powerful solution for streamlined web scraping and data extraction., It offers a user-friendly API with features such as effortless proxy management, automatic parsing, and country-specific targeting. With Scraper API, users can simplify complex scraping tasks and access structured data from diverse websites.

Key Features of Scraper API

  • Effortless Web Scraping and Data Extraction: The Scraper API is a user-friendly web scraping tool that efficiently retrieves HTML code from various websites, including those with JavaScript-heavy content, through simple API calls. 
  • Proxy Management and CAPTCHA Bypass: The tool manages proxies, browsers, and CAPTCHAs, allowing users to extract HTML from web pages with ease, backed by over 40 million global IPs. 
  • Structured Data and Automatic Parsing: The API offers structured JSON data from popular platforms like Amazon, Google Search, and Google Shopping, with advanced auto-parsing capabilities for simplified data collection.
  • Scheduler and Country-Specific Targeting: The Scraper API provides a Scheduler feature for scheduling recurring tasks and localized search results from 195 countries, enabling precise country-specific targeting. 
  • Seamless Integration and Extensive Documentation: The Scraper API integration process is straightforward, with comprehensive documentation and SDKs for various programming languages like cURL, Python, Node.js, PHP, Ruby, and Java. 

In summary, Scraper API emerges as a comprehensive solution for web scraping and data extraction, boasting features such as proxy management, structured data extraction, and ease of integration.

Conclusion

As we navigate the vast landscape of the internet, the importance of the best web crawler tools becomes increasingly evident. From saving time and resources to empowering strategic decision-making, these tools are indispensable in today’s data-driven world. Whether you’re a developer, data scientist, or business professional, having the right scraping tool at your disposal can make all the difference. As we look ahead to 2024, consider incorporating these best web crawler tools into your toolkit for efficient and effective data extraction. APISCRAPY, along with other tools mentioned, will undoubtedly play a significant role in shaping the future of web scraping.

Get Notified !

Receive email each time we publish something new:

Jyothish Chief Data Officer

Jyothish - Chief Data Officer

A visionary operations leader with over 14+ years of diverse industry experience in managing projects and teams across IT, automobile, aviation, and semiconductor product companies. Passionate about driving innovation and fostering collaborative teamwork and helping others achieve their goals.

Certified scuba diver, avid biker, and globe-trotter, he finds inspiration in exploring new horizons both in work and life. Through his impactful writing, he continues to inspire.

Related Articles

Pin It on Pinterest

Share This